  1. Forty Eight Hours to Acapulco (German: 48 Stunden bis Acapulco) is a 1967 West German crime film directed by Klaus Lemke and starring Dieter Geissler, Christiane Krüger and Monika Zinnenberg. Location shooting took place in Bavaria, Italy and Mexico.

  6. Acapulco lies about 380 km south of Mexico City, and 1050 km southeast of Puerto Vallarta. Non-stop flights to Acapulco take 1 hour 15 minutes from Mexico City, 1 hour 50 minutes from Monterrey, and 3 hours 30 minutes from Tijuana.
